The Really Right Stuff TFCT-34L Mk2 SOAR® Series 3 Carbon Fiber Tripod with Anvil-30 ARC Ball Head is built for professionals who demand absolute performance in the harshest environments. Favoured by military units, law enforcement, competitive shooters, and anyone seeking the tallest and most capable field tripod, this model sets a new benchmark for rugged dependability and versatility.
Standing at a maximum height of 181cm (71.1"), the TFCT-34L Mk2 excels in steep terrain and unpredictable landscapes, offering shooters a commanding vantage point without sacrificing stability. Its four-section carbon fibre legs and refined construction deliver a load capacity of up to 36kg (80lbs) in its primary position, ensuring rock-solid support for even the heaviest of setups.
Fitted with the Anvil-30 ARC ball head, this system is R-Lock compatible, offering enhanced security and rapid mount engagement for ARCA-style plates. The ball head remains backward compatible with non R-Lock accessories, ensuring seamless integration with existing gear.
Weighing just 2.5kg (5.5lbs) and folding down to 68cm, this tripod balances height and strength with portability. From ultra-low positions of 17cm to full extension, its stability across all shooting angles is unmatched.
Included in the box are the TFCT tripod, Anvil-30 ARC ball head pre-installed, hex keys for adjustment, and a user guide – everything needed to deploy this professional-grade platform straight out of the box. Number of Leg Sections: 4
-
Load Capacity (1st Position, Fully Extended): 80lbs / 36kg
-
Load Capacity (2nd Position, Fully Extended): 45lbs / 20kg
-
Load Capacity (3rd Position, Fully Collapsed): 65lbs / 29kg
-
1st Position Maximum Height: 71.1" / 181cm
-
1st Position Minimum Height: 24.6" / 62cm
-
1st Position (3/4 Segments Extended): 54.4" / 138cm
-
2nd Position Maximum Height: 49.7" / 126cm
-
2nd Position Minimum Height: 18.1" / 46cm
-
3rd Position Minimum Height: 6.7" / 17cm
-
Folded Length: 26.6" / 68cm
-
Folded Diameter: 4.1" / 10.4cm
-
Weight: 5.50lbs / 2495g
